在正常启动springboot后,无法访问规定的路径

问题遇到的现象和发生背景

按照书籍编写的代码,在正常启动springboot后,无法访问规定的路径

问题相关代码,请勿粘贴截图

img

img

    @RequestMapping("/table")
    public ModelAndView table() {
        // 访问模型层得到数据
        List userList = userService.findUsers(null, null);
        // 模型和视图
        ModelAndView mv = new ModelAndView();
        // 定义模型视图
        mv.setViewName("user/table");
        // 加入数据模型
        mv.addObject("userList", userList);
        // 返回模型和视图
        return mv;
    }

运行结果及报错内容

img

我的解答思路和尝试过的方法

尝试过Application启动类的位置,确定其没错,

img

还有视图的配置

img

我想要达到的结果

能够正常访问我想要访问的页面

没有指定方法的访问类型吧,。get,put,post等

修改Model名试一下:mv.setViewName("table");

application.preperties 中有没有配置 server. servlet.context-path=xxx,如果有配置,把这个值,放到8080 后面: :8080/xxx/user/table

端口后边加上项目名访问试试

请加上项目名,引入service为什么要加上null

/table 没有在user controller里面?
你在浏览器访问的是controller 你setviewName 是你的页面位置

控制器加一个注解@ResponseBody或者把@Controller修改为@RestConmtroller